NEW DEGREE OR CERTIFICATE-SEEKING STUDENTS:
- Submit the application with a $25 application fee. The quickest and easiest way is to apply online.
- Have an official copy of your high school transcript sent to the Admissions Office, or, if you have a GED, have those scores sent to the Admissions Office. If you have attended college previously you should also have your transcript sent from your prior college. Prior college credit may transfer and may exempt you from placement testing.
- If you have never been to college before and you want to enroll in a major you will need to take our College Placement Test. If you have taken the test here before you do not have to take it again.
- If you have been admitted to a degree or certificate program and have taken the College Placement Test, you may sign up for anOrientation session. At Orientation, you will meet with an academic advisor, register for classes and learn from other students and professionals about life at MCC. If you have been admitted and tested or notified that you are exempt from testing, email orientation@middlesexcc.edu. If you have questions about Orientation, please call 732-516-7820.
- New English as a Second Language (ESL) students meet by appointment with advisors in the ESL Department.
- Do not forget to apply for financial aid. It is recommended that any student interested in receiving financial aid for the summer or fall semester apply on line as soon as possible at www.fafsa.ed.gov. Payment plans are available to students taking 6 or more credits. Plan to pay your bill to the College. If you receive financial aid you will be reimbursed.
- Purchase your books.
